Sometime last year, I had the idea to put together a script for a short film. I had never written anything to that degree before, aside from the poetry I occasionally dabble in. As someone who is predominantly a visual artist, this was a very different form of creative expression than what I’m used to. So I started writing. I told a story, partially my own, about the loss of passion. I poured my heart and mind into it. But writing it was only the first step; the real task was bringing it to life. I had my eyes on some talented individuals, @the.kenke and @_blaq.king . I shared the script with them and they were on board. I then reached out to Smart to be my DP, and he also assisted with direction. For a few scenes, I needed paintings, which @konyeha_artceptuality generously provided. And when it came to securing a location for one of the scenes, @victorolophastudios graciously made his space available, and a big thank you to @kiisha.brown for the costumes. In many ways, this film became a different kind of curation for me. Producing and directing were very different shoes to fill, but I found that I truly enjoyed wearing them. The entire process was deeply fulfilling, and I’m excited to finally share what we created very soon.
